QT4 / 5 O criador não pode encontrar -lGL

0

Eu instalei o SDK móvel do Ubuntu há um tempo atrás na minha máquina Ubuntu 13.04 via link

Após alguns dias, apareceu um erro de compilador / vinculador - mesmo ao compilar o projeto GUI padrão para QT:

cannot find -lGL
collect2: error: ld returned 1 exit status

Um projeto mundial não QT c ++ hello compila e finge iniciar (diz no ide start) mas nunca diz "Hello World" ou até mesmo sai.

Além disso, o QT-Creator de repente teve um bug estranho. Quando eu cliquei em "Develop", algumas janelas que não podem ser fechadas apareceram como uma captura de tela da janela do criador do qt.

Não consegui descobrir o que aconteceu, por isso decidi desinstalar o SDK e voltar à versão padrão do QT Creator. Eu usei ppa-purge no SDK ppa e por isso eu desinstalei o SDK ... espero. Mas ainda recebo os mesmos erros. Apenas aquele bug estranho desapareceu.

Eu também tentei remover o criador do QT do apt-get, mas ele não pareceu funcionar (nenhuma configuração foi perdida após a reinstalação).

Eu pensei que talvez devesse tentar instalar o SDK novamente, mas ouvi que é complicado quando eu misturo coisas QT4 e QT5. Então eu decidi pedir uma resposta aqui.

Então, minha pergunta é: como posso fazer o QT Creator funcionar novamente? Eu realmente não me importo se eu uso QT4 ou QT5. Eu não escrevi tanto assim isso não é problema. Eu prefiro o QT5, no entanto. Obrigado.

    
por verpfeilt 08.06.2013 / 21:08

1 resposta

1

Tente isso sudo apt-get instala libglu1-mesa-dev

    
por Sergey 05.07.2013 / 06:27